Adding Unique ID (number) to the form
- Ahmed OsamaAsked on October 18, 2013 at 01:42 PM
how can i put a unique number to my registration form and the number appear to the user to come to the marathon with his application number ?
- JotForm SupportMike_TAnswered on October 18, 2013 at 02:51 PM
Thank you for contacting us.
You can add an Unique ID field to the form:
Add Custom Unique IDs to your Form Submissions
That field is hidden on the form, but you can show its value to user on a form Thank You Page:
Additionally, you can add a Form Email Autoresponder with this unique number.
